Launching snow

Snow in the UK does not compare at all to snow in, say, France, New Zealand or Canada; but when it does come and actually sticks, the nation really does try to make the most of it. So, it snowed in London on Saturday 4th February.  By the time I was off to bed, it … Continue reading

Rate this: